The ocean is salty because it contains many dissolved ions. as these charged particles move with the water in strong ocean currents, they feel a force from the earth's magnetic field. positive and negative charges are separated until an electric field develops that balances this magnetic force. this field produces measurable potential differ- ences that can be monitored by ocean researchers. the gulf stream moves northward off the east coast of the united states at a speed of up to 3.5 m/s. assume that the current flows at this maximum speed and that the earth's field is 50 ut tipped 60° below horizontal 63. what is the direction of the magnetic force on a singly ion- ized negative chlorine ion moving in this ocean current? a. east b. west c. up d. down 64. what is the magnitude of the force on this ion? a. 2.8 x 10-23 n b. 2.4 x 10-23 n c. 1.6 x 10-23 n d. 1.4 x 10-23 n 65. what magnitude electric field is necessary to exactly balance this magnetic force? a. 1.8 x 104 n/c b. 1.5 x 10-4n/c c. 1.0 x 10 - n/c d. 0.9 x 10 - n/c 66. the electric field produces a potential difference. if you place one electrode 10 m below the surface of the water, you will measure the greatest potential difference if you place the second electrode a. at the surface. b. at a depth of 20 m. c. at the same depth 10 m to the north. d. at the same depth 10 m to the east.
